What Is Kilometers per Liter (km/L)?

Kilometers per liter (km/L) is a unit used to measure fuel efficiency. It represents how many kilometers a vehicle can travel using one liter of fuel.

For example:

  • 15 km/L means the vehicle can travel 15 kilometers using one liter of fuel.

Fuel economy units like km/L measure distance per fuel unit, meaning the higher the number, the more efficient the vehicle is.

Many countries such as India, Japan, and several Asian regions commonly use km/L as the standard measurement for vehicle mileage.

How to Calculate Kilometers per Liter

The formula used to calculate fuel efficiency in kilometers per liter is simple.

km/L Formula

km/L = Distance Traveled (km) ÷ Fuel Used (liters)

This formula calculates the number of kilometers a vehicle can travel using one liter of fuel.

Example Calculation

Let’s calculate the fuel efficiency for a car.

Example Data

Distance traveled = 450 km
Fuel used = 30 liters

Calculation

km/L =

450 ÷ 30

km/L = 15 km/L

This means the vehicle can travel 15 kilometers using one liter of fuel.

Another Example

Example Data

Distance traveled = 620 km
Fuel used = 40 liters

Calculation

km/L =

620 ÷ 40

km/L = 15.5 km/L

This indicates that the vehicle’s fuel efficiency is 15.5 km per liter.

km/L vs L/100km

Fuel efficiency can also be expressed as liters per 100 kilometers (L/100km).

Difference Between the Two

UnitMeaningEfficiency
km/LDistance traveled per literHigher = better
L/100kmFuel used per 100 kmLower = better

For example:

km/LL/100km
20 km/L5 L/100km
15 km/L6.67 L/100km
10 km/L10 L/100km

Both units measure the same concept but express it differently.

Converting km/L to L/100km

You can convert km/L to liters per 100 km using this formula:

Conversion Formula

L/100km = 100 ÷ km/L

Example

20 km/L

L/100km =

100 ÷ 20 = 5 L/100km

Converting L/100km to km/L

To convert L/100km back to km/L:

Conversion Formula

km/L = 100 ÷ L/100km

Example

5 L/100km

km/L =

100 ÷ 5 = 20 km/L

Converting km/L to MPG

Fuel efficiency is also measured in miles per gallon (MPG) in some countries.

Conversion Formula

MPG = km/L × 2.352

Example:

15 km/L

MPG =

15 × 2.352 = 35.28 MPG

This helps drivers compare fuel efficiency internationally.

Typical Fuel Economy Values

Fuel efficiency varies depending on vehicle type and engine size.

Vehicle TypeAverage km/L
Small compact car18–25 km/L
Sedan12–18 km/L
SUV8–14 km/L
Pickup truck6–12 km/L

Vehicles with smaller engines and lighter weight usually achieve higher fuel efficiency.

Factors That Affect Fuel Economy

Many factors influence how efficiently a vehicle uses fuel.

Engine Size

Larger engines typically consume more fuel.

Vehicle Weight

Heavier vehicles require more energy to move.

Driving Style

Aggressive acceleration and braking reduce fuel efficiency.

Tire Pressure

Underinflated tires increase rolling resistance.

Road Conditions

Driving uphill or in heavy traffic increases fuel consumption.

Vehicle Maintenance

Poorly maintained engines can significantly reduce fuel efficiency.
